Is it really worth the hype? The oldest I have smoked is about 5 years old and it was pretty good. Is there a point of no return where it has passed how good it was or could be?

Looking for advice because not sure about how long I should plan to keep my current stash as I bought them to burn and not to collect.

There is no magic formula. Every vintage year is different  and every marca is different. One of the most important factors is how the cigars have been kept. Temp, humidity, and air circulation all effect how they age.

" Is there a point of no return where it has passed how good it was or could be? "

Yes,there is a peak,and a decline.

This decline may take a long time,and even an extremely old cigar can be magical.

The cigars made before 2003 have the potential to reach the amazing complexity found in Cuban cigars for decades.
After 2003?  We need time to find that out.......
